The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
PENTRIDGE SU 01 NW PENTRIDGE VILLAGE (North-west side)
3/76 Pair of cottages 120m south of St Rumbold's Church
GV II
Pair of cottages, C17 or earlier origin, much reworked C19. Brick faced chalk cob, whitewashed. Thatched roof with brick stacks to ends of main range. L-plan with projecting cross-wing left. One and a half storeys, irregular fenestration. 2 and 3-light casements, mostly C19 with glazing bars. The cross wing contains one single-light wrought-iron casement with leaded-lights. Ground floor windows under segmental heads. Each cottage has a plank door in a gabled porch.
